Abstract :
The use of Golay Complementary Pairs to synchronize a multiple-input multiple-output (MIMO) channel is presented in this paper. The Golay code´s correlation properties make it ideal for this purpose. Golay codes have been used for synchronization before and has also been suggested for possible use in MIMO channels. However we have not seen it implemented and physically tested in the past. This paper shows the generation, simulation and implementation of such a code scheme on field programmable gate array (FPGA) and investigates it´s performance on a MIMO channel. The results show excellent correlation of better than 90dB and almost perfect synchronization hence confirming that Golay codes or its complementary pair is a good candidate for MIMO synchronization.
